KOSPI at new 2008 peak, but techs limit gains

SEOUL, May 16 (Reuters) - Seoul shares inched up on Friday, extending recent gains to hit a new 2008 closing high led by shipbuilders, but the index gave up much of its early advance on losses by tech shares such as LG Display (034220.KS: Quote, Profile, Research, Stock Buzz).

The Korea Composite Stock Price Index closed 0.17 percent higher at 1,888.88 points after a 0.7 percent gain in early trade that helped it turn positive on the year, fully recouping the 19 percent drop that brought it to its mid-March low.

The KOSPI's session high of 1,899.57 points took the index above 2007's closing of 1,897.13 for the first time this year.
